Turkish PM visits quake-hit Pakistan to express sympathy

ISLAMABAD, Oct. 20 (Xinhua) -- Turkish Prime Minister Tayyip Erdogan arrived here Thursday on a two-day visit to express sympathy with Pakistani leaders over the devastating earthquake.

Erdogan will visit Muzaffarabad, capital of Pakistan-controlled Kashmir, on Friday to personally assess the widespread damage caused by the Oct. 8 quake.

The Turkish premier is the first world head of the government to visit Pakistan after the massive quake, which officials say has killed over 49,000 people and injured more than 70,000 others in the country.

Erdogan will also meet with Pakistani President General Pervez Musharraf and hold talks with Prime Minister Shaukat Aziz.
